Located just a few minutes walk
from Covent Garden, not far from the City's business area, the
Citadines London Holborn Covent Garden, is 45 miles from both
the Heathrow and Gatwick Airports. Nestled in the midst of a shopper's
paradise, surrounded by pubs (the 16th-century, Lamb and Flag,
the 17th-century Ye Olde Cheshire Cheese), restaurants, galleries,
churches and the converted 19th-century fruit and vegetable market.
Not far away, other fascinating places like Piccadilly and Oxford
Street will give you a taste of the pace of life in London today.
The London Transport Museum and the Royal Opera House are both
to be found here. Ancient Egypt and Rome await you at the British
Museum, as do some seven million exhibits. For nightlife, the
Covent Garden area offers numerous restaurants, cinemas and jazz
clubs as does nearby Soho. For one night, several days or more,
benefit from the space of an apartment with kitchen, bathroom,
satellite television, individual private telephone number, and
in most residences, an individual safety box and Hi-fi. Make yourself
at home, cook for yourself, or order in your favorite dinner from
local take-away caterers. The three-star hotel offers 192 flats
over six floors, including 152 studios for on or two people and
40 one-bedroom apartments for one to four people. Each studio
has sofa or pull-out bed while the flats have sofa or pull out
bed in the lounge and one double or two single beds in the bedroom.
Citadines Holborn Covent Garden is convenient to fine dining,
shopping and entertainment venues. Please note: The hotel offers
maid service only once a week. Guests staying for less than a
week, may have their rooms cleaned for a fee. |
